They already feel that the Giants are being cheap so they frame this as a fiasco because the Giants "lowballed" Shilo early on and what not, then ended up paying over slot in the 9th round when he would have been around slot in the fifth round.<br /><br />Now, I don't know what happened or what their preferences are, but to me, it could also be viewed as the Giants preferring the players they drafted in the rounds they did, and they were hoping to pick up Shilo at some point, but not over the guys they had selected already. They then decided to pull the trigger, because it is not that much money.<br /><br />But their view is that by being penurious, the Giants almost lost this player that they clearly liked.<br /><br />What they don't realize is that every team has a lot of different prospects that they like and are negotiating with, and it is a volume business, if not one, then the other, and then you move on when you lose one or another on your list.<br /><br />And at $200,000, that's not a very high probability prospect, he could certainly beat the odds and reach the majors, but the odds are totally against him.<br /><br />But that is the beauty of baseball, when somebody beats the oods, like Ryan Vogelsong or any prospect who was drafted way back in the draft and makes it to become a regular.obsessivegiantscompulsivehttps://www.blogger.com/profile/11362706004246875823no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-23735245.post-33425384720532722572012-06-13T17:31:55.263-07:002012-06-13T17:31:55.263-07:00Also, I'm not sure why the McCall draft and si...Also, I'm not sure why the McCall draft and signing is still being referred to in some corners of the internet as a "fiasco."
